Description
Crispy Parmesan Zucchini Fries coated in panko and parmesan, perfect for a healthy snack or side dish.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3 small zucchinis
- 2 eggs
- 1 pinch salt
- Ground black pepper
- 2 cups Japanese panko bread crumbs
- 1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
- Ranch dressing
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 425°F (218°C).
- Slice the zucchinis into lengths of about 3 inches (7 cm) and cut them into strips that are 1/2 inch (1 cm) thick.
- Beat the eggs in a bowl and mix in a pinch of salt and ground black pepper.
-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Combine the panko and parmesan cheese on a plate.
- Dip each zucchini strip into the beaten eggs, shaking off excess egg mixture.
- Roll the zucchini in the panko mixture, pressing gently to coat thoroughly.
- Transfer the coated zucchini fries to the prepared baking sheet.
- Bake for about 20 to 25 minutes, turning halfway through, until golden brown and crispy.
- Serve immediately with ranch dressing.
Notes
For extra flavor, add spices like garlic powder or Italian herbs to the panko mixture.
